Basically the rear differential just has a little spring cap on the top of it that opens and closes the air vent in the rear differential. It gets stuck open and crap gets in it. The front has a line running from it to allow air without junk but the rear doesn’t. It’s cheap to install and can prevent needing a diff repair. The below video is exactly what I bought and installed.

Yakima jetstream bars (50”)

4 baseline towers

Baseclip 179 (front set)

Baseclip 124 (rear set)

And then the locks

It’s expensive retail but I found a guy on reddit who ships and refurbishes setups. He has pretty much everything you could need and will tell you specs for measurement and torque. I paid $480 from him instead of like $850 retail. PM me and I’ll shoot you his username
